Output d17892786e71fed4b82bd286b50a566632ea619261f65feb4efc606dc8eeffc3:6
- value
- 57766
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b18e171f228d3c1f5a81ebf4954e9ea3ce23949 OP_EQUAL
- address
- 34AHyTg26HjDbAWbm5wRUcapsjxeWeEC5n
- transaction
- d17892786e71fed4b82bd286b50a566632ea619261f65feb4efc606dc8eeffc3